What is Open for Teachers?
Open for Teachers is a professional development program for teachers and school leaders to be sensitized and empowered about free and open education resources (OER) adaptable in the classroom; become part of a community of educators using these resources and access support for technology integration in the school.
Why Open for Teachers?
We have found out that there is a dearth of support for educators use of educational technology; professional development for schools are scarce and expensive and it is not a priority for most schools because of paucity of funds; and most schools (leaders and teachers) don't understand how to effectively and appropriately adopt technology in classroom. This program therefore assists schools to navigate the rocky route by mitigating the cost of technology adoption while still maintaining quality.

What is the model of the workshop?
Open for Teachers seeks the most impact driven and sustainable pathway for schools to be sensitized and expand in the use of free and open education resource (OER) coupled with adopting technology effectively. Therefore, each school must nominate tech savvy teachers and/or at least those revered already by colleagues in school to be apt with technology. A blended (2 days online and 1 day face-2-face) workshop will be organized to initiate the teachers into the process. Afterwards, they will be required to cascade the training with other colleagues in their school. Based on their knowledge of the systems in their respective schools, they will be required to design a template for technology adoption which will be reviewed by expert facilitators. This will then be taken back to the school leaders for alignment and implementation.
